VI. VENDOR RESPONSE

We had a response from Craig Knudsen, the project leader, on 20051128
night. The same day the fast Craig resolved 3 of the 4 issues in the
REL_1_0_0 branch of CVS, so soon a new version (probably 1.0.2) will be
released to the public.
